| 0:19.2 | Hello and welcome to coffee house shots. |
| 0:20.8 | I'm James Heel. |
| 0:21.6 | I'm joined today by Isabel Hartman and Fraser Nelson. |
| 0:24.1 | We've reached the end of a tumultuous week in British politics, MPs are now in their |
| 0:27.7 | constituency on this Friday morning, but I think everyone's really picking over |
| 0:31.2 | what just happened this week with the speaker |
| 0:32.9 | forced twice to apologize for his decision on the Wednesday votes on the Gaza |
| 0:37.8 | ceasefire. Fraser what do you make of it all? I think this has been quite a historic |
| 0:42.0 | week for Parliament. because we've had |
| 0:46.6 | first of all a huge debate over the correct proceedings of an opposition day debate. |
| 0:50.6 | This would be normally, this only happens about three or four times a year with a smaller |
| 0:53.9 | opposition party gets to do its own debate. Normally absolutely nobody cares. Nobody cares what anybody says, |
| 0:59.9 | nobody cares when anybody votes, but this time it's become thrust right into the center of the |
| 1:05.1 | British political debate, and that debate has been about the probity, about the Constitution, |
| 1:10.0 | about the standing orders of the House of Commons. |
| 1:14.0 | Now, we've had the, I think the scenes which we saw on Wednesday were absolutely extraordinary, |
| 1:19.8 | a speaker, a speaker being heckled, being jeered, he's supposed to be the figure of complete authority |
